Post by tim on Jul 26, 2022 20:51:11 GMT -5
2. “It Matters to Me” - Faith Hill Released: December 1995 Billboard Peak: #1 / Billboard Year-End: #14 Total: 291 Average: 17.12 Std Dev: 16.03 (2nd LOWEST!)
1. “Heads Carolina, Tails California” - Jo Dee Messina Released: January 1996 Billboard Peak: #2 / Billboard Year-End: #52 Total: 209 Average: 12.29 Std Dev: 11.50 (LOWEST!)

Few singers can do an upbeat uptempo that lifts your spirits, while also being able to wreck you with a languishing ballad the next, as well as Jo Dee Messina. Her sass is unmatched, but the vocal performance of something like "Even God Must Get the Blues" is absolutely masterclass. I feel like she should be remembered a lot better than she is as an artist. She has a few HUGE singles that are forever engrained in country radio gold playlists, but her status as an artist definitely took a hit from being saddled to Curb Records. If she'd been on a major label, she probably would've had a longer shelf life (they just flat-out killed her career in 2006) and I'm sad that their ineptitude as a label took a toll on how well her legacy has held up.
